Invention Panel: Education to Foster Future Inventors and Innovators

Amid the backdrop of traditional education, where memorization often overshadows imagination, a private high school in Bulgaria is redefining learning. The school isn’t merely nurturing students; it’s cultivating curious minds eager to embark on a collaborative journey of discovery. Here, students aren’t viewed as empty vessels to be filled with easy solutions and readymade answers. Instead, they are seen as inquisitive explorers entering the second-largest educational community of its kind in the country.

Drawing its strength from blending cutting-edge technology with comprehensive education, this institution emphasizes the growing necessity of digital literacy across multiple fields. It’s no surprise that students graduating from this school emerge equipped with indispensable digital skills that enhance their chosen career paths.

Remarkably, this educational haven does not restrict opportunity to just those who can afford it. Nearly 20% of the students are granted full scholarships, financed by public funds, cementing the school’s commitment to accessible quality education for all.

Among the myriad tales of student success, one stands out vividly—a young pupil, whose ingenuity led to the creation of a software solution still at use in the family business. Tasked by the student’s father to help develop this project, the school’s mentors played a pivotal role as supporters and catalysts. This budding innovator presented the software as his graduation project before embarking on further study abroad, already leaving a mark in the business world with his resourcefulness and skills honed at the school.

This story isn’t an isolated case. The school’s philosophy underscores that educational reform must rekindle a love of learning. Their vision is that students see education as not just relevant, but also engaging. Central to this is a shift away from rote learning towards evaluating practical skills that genuinely prepare students for life beyond school walls. Their bold strategy argues for curricula focused on real-world skills, developed under the guidance of teachers who are less instructors and more mentors. These educators inspire trust and respect, walking alongside their students as coaches in every step of their development.

Through focusing on creativity, a guided embrace of technology, and nurturing an intrinsic love for learning, this institution exemplifies a paradigm of education that is not just about amassing knowledge, but about empowering students to craft solutions, fuel innovation, and truly impact their world. Here, education is not an obligation, but a passport to endless possibilities.
